function template
<valarray>
std::cosh
template<class T> valarray<T> cosh (const valarray<T>& x);
Compute hyperbolic cosine of valarray elements
Returns a valarray containing the hyperbolic cosines of all the elements of x, in the same order.
The function calls cosh (unqualified) once for each element.
This function overloads cmath's cosh.
Parameters
- x
- valarray containing elements of a type for which the unary function cosh is defined.
Return value
A valarray object with the hyperbolic cosine values of the elements of x.

 | // cosh valarray example
#include <iostream>     // std::cout
#include <cstddef>      // std::size_t
#include <cmath>        // std::cosh(double)
#include <valarray>     // std::valarray, std::cos(valarray)
int main ()
{
  double val[] = {0.35, 1.22, 3.4};
  std::valarray<double> foo (val,3);
  std::valarray<double> bar = cosh (foo);
  std::cout << "foo:";
  for (std::size_t i=0; i<foo.size(); ++i)
    std::cout << ' ' << foo[i];
  std::cout << '\n';
  std::cout << "bar:";
  for (std::size_t i=0; i<bar.size(); ++i)
    std::cout << ' ' << bar[i];
  std::cout << '\n';
  return 0;
}
 | 
Output:
| 
foo: 0.35 1.22 3.4
bar: 1.06188 1.84121 14.9987
